hello. I'm selling from sri lanka my item cost 4 dollars weights abt 1.4 oz but when i calculate shipping cost it was aprox. 13 dollars[cheapest shipping service I could find]-USPS first class mail international..
I m a new seller if i list my item so I'm definite, it would never sell..
please help me out ..what should i do? .is there a different shipping service that i could use ?
should i use free shipping and list shipping cost to my items price?. [ think its bit unfair]

I'm also afraid you will have trouble selling the unbranded eyeglasses as it stands now. Your listing needs work, but it is a good starting point. The description gives too few details about what you are selling. I know you may have seen other sellers say "See pictures for details" etc. but that does little to inform the customer and is not a good selling strategy. The title and Item Specifics should also be descriptive. Check out some of your competition to see how they do theirs, and read completed listings too. This can give you ideas of how to set up a listing to better maximize your potential.
As for the shipping question, I see you have put in "Free shipping". I think that is risky. You could end up spending the entire asking price of $15.99 just in shipping alone, as i'm sure you're aware that international rates can get expensive. You have not excluded any countries you ship to so there is no way to adequately predict how much it's going to cost you in postage to mail the package to anywhere in the world. "Free" shipping needs to be rolled into your price as well as ebay and PayPal fees as you know. You'd be better off with calculated shipping. Also, you need to take your shipping time into consideration when selling internationally. Buyers usually don't want to wait weeks for their items to arrive. That's working against you.
So you have some hurdles to jump here. Sorry i couldn't be of more help. Good luck to you.

You can't ship USPS mail from Sri Lanka. You need to get a quote as to how much it ships for from your own country to th USA. Preferably with tracking.
